In a study of 102 bronchograms for purposes of comparing the contrast medium Visciodol® (a mixture of iodized peanut oil and powdered sulfanilamide) with Iodochlorol® (an iodized poppyseed oil), it was observed that Visciodol is more readily administered, produces better bronchograms with less alveolar filling and clears from the lungs far more rapidly and completely than does Iodochlorol.Certain even newer highly promising agents are available but specific results with them are not included with this report.Bronchography is a diagnostic procedure that is contraindicated when the information to be gained does not exceed the probable risk.
